InCareS – Environment: Individualised Care Environment to Support self-management and independence

Care environment is an under-used resource in the care of older people making this research topic utmost important. InCareS Environment research focus on analysing the impact of care environment on patient outcomes, explaining variations in care individualization, analysing individuals’ own resources to enhance their own conditions, self-management, independence and meaningful life in different care environments. Environment is defined in terms of physical, build environment, social and symbolic (culture, language, religion/ spirituality, society norms) environment.
